An efficient preparation of peri-hydroxy dihydroquinone derivatives through a Pummerer-type rearrangement of silylene-protected peri-hydroxy aromatic sulfoxides
Kita, Yasuyuki,Takeda, Yoshifumi,Iio, Kiyosei,Yokogawa, Kayoko,Takahashi, Kenji,Akai, Shuji
, p. 7545 - 7548 (2007/10/03)
Silylene protection of two dihydroxy groups of the peri-hydroxy aromatic sulfides 6a-f was essential for the subsequent Pummerer-type reaction. The overall process provided a novel and efficient approach to the peri-hydroxy dihydroquinone derivatives 9a-f.
